Description

The Impulse KLYM sits at the top of the Savage straight-pull lineup, and it earns that spot. Instead of a traditional lift-and-cycle bolt, the Impulse action pulls straight back and pushes straight forward, so you can run a follow-up shot without breaking your cheek weld or coming off the animal. The Hexlock bolt system locks the action tight, and the whole bolt assembly can be swapped from right to left hand, which makes this one of the few premium hunting rifles that treats lefties as more than an afterthought.

Carbon Fiber Where It Counts on the Impulse KLYM

Savage went to the right partners for the weight savings. The 22 inch barrel is a PROOF Research carbon fiber wrapped stainless steel tube, cut rifled with a 1:10 twist that stabilizes the full range of .308 Winchester bullet weights. The stock comes from FBT (Fine Ballistic Tools), blending carbon fiber in the forend and buttstock with an additive-manufactured center section, plus a comb that adjusts with a single button so you can get your eye behind the scope quickly. Add the aluminum receiver and the whole rifle comes in around 6.6 pounds, which your legs will appreciate on day three of an elk hunt.

Set Up for Glass and the Long Haul

There are no iron sights here, and there don't need to be. The receiver wears an integral one-piece 20 MOA rail, so mounting a scope with plenty of elevation for longer pokes is simple. The muzzle is threaded 5/8-24 and ships with an Omni-Port brake that takes real bite out of recoil, and the adjustable AccuTrigger lets you dial the pull to your liking without a trip to a gunsmith. Feeding comes from a 4 round detachable box magazine, giving you 4+1 on tap.

Who the Impulse KLYM .308 Makes Sense For

This rifle is built for the hunter who counts ounces and covers ground: high country mule deer, backcountry elk, long walks after whitetail. The speed of the straight-pull action also makes it a strong pick anywhere a quick second shot matters. It costs more than a standard bolt gun, but the barrel, stock, and action here are genuinely a class above.

Key Specifications

  • Manufacturer Part Number: 58104
  • UPC: 011356581044
  • Caliber: .308 Win / 7.62 NATO
  • Action: Straight-Pull Bolt Action (Ambidextrous)
  • Barrel: 22" PROOF Research Carbon Fiber Wrapped Stainless Steel
  • Twist Rate: 1:10"
  • Muzzle: Omni-Port Brake, 5/8-24 Threaded
  • Capacity: 4+1, Detachable Box Magazine
  • Stock: FBT (Fine Ballistic Tools) Carbon Fiber, Adjustable Comb
  • Receiver: Aluminum with Integral 20 MOA Picatinny Rail
  • Trigger: Adjustable AccuTrigger
  • Safety: 2-Position Tang
  • Weight: 6.6 lbs
  • Overall Length: 45.37"
  • Sights: None, Optics Ready

Frequently Asked Questions

How is the Impulse KLYM different from a standard bolt-action rifle?

The Impulse uses a straight-pull action, so the bolt cycles with a simple back-and-forward motion instead of the usual lift, pull, push, and lock. That means faster follow-up shots and less movement behind the scope. Savage's Hexlock system uses six bearings to lock the bolt into the barrel extension for a secure, consistent lockup.

Is the Savage Impulse KLYM good for left-handed hunters?

Yes, and better than most. The bolt handle and bolt assembly can be swapped from the right side to the left without a gunsmith, and the tang safety is naturally ambidextrous. It's one of the more genuinely lefty-friendly premium hunting rifles on the market.

Does the Impulse KLYM come with sights or a scope?

No sights or optic are included. The receiver has an integral one-piece 20 MOA Picatinny rail machined right in, so all you need is a set of rings and your scope of choice. The 20 MOA cant gives you extra elevation for stretching the .308 out at longer ranges.

Can I suppress the Impulse KLYM in .308?

The muzzle is threaded 5/8-24, which is the standard pattern for most .30 caliber suppressors and muzzle devices. Just remove the included Omni-Port brake and thread on your can. The carbon fiber wrapped PROOF barrel also helps offset the added weight of a suppressor.
